Abstract

An atomizing electronic cigarette has an atomizing core component and a liquid storage component. including an electric heater. The electric heater may have a through hole aligned with a channel passing through the liquid storage component. The cigarette can heat and uniformly vaporize liquid from the liquid storage component, with the user inhaling the vaporized liquid. The vapor generated by the atomizing process may be cooled as it flows through the channel.

Claims (25)

1. An electronic cigarette, comprising:

a first housing having a battery;

a second housing attached to the first housing, the second housing including an inhalation port;

a liquid storage component and an atomizing core in the second housing, the atomizing core including a wire coil electrically connectable to the battery for atomizing liquid from the liquid storage component;

the atomizing core centrally supported in the second housing on a bracket; and

a channel extending through and surrounded by the liquid storage component, with the channel and the inhalation port forming an airflow path centrally located within the second housing, and with the channel providing a continuous passageway from the wire coil to the inhalation port.

2. The electronic cigarette of claim 1 further including an air-intake connection component and an electrode ring on the bracket, the wire coil electrically connected to the battery through the electrode ring.

3. The electronic cigarette of claim 2 further including a ring post in the first housing engageable with the electrode ring.

4. The electronic cigarette of claim 3 further including a contact part on the electrode ring post extending axially and contacting the electrode ring.

5. The electronic cigarette of claim 1 further a sensor in the first housing electrically connected to the battery.

6. The electronic cigarette of claim 5 further comprising an auxiliary air inlet in the first housing leading into the channel via an air vent through the bracket.

7. The electronic cigarette of claim 1 wherein the wire coil is in the channel.

8. The electronic cigarette of claim 7 wherein the wire coil is surrounded by the liquid storage component.

9. The electronic cigarette of claim 7 wherein the wire coil is at a first end of the channel.

10. The electronic cigarette of claim 1 further comprising a liquid conduction component having an axial section and a radial section, the radial section contacting an end of the liquid conduction component.

11. The electronic cigarette of claim 10 further comprising a liquid permeating component sleeved on wire coil and in contact with the axial section of the liquid conduction component.

12. An electronic cigarette, comprising:

a first housing having a battery;

a sensor in the first housing electrically connected to the battery;

a second housing attached to the first housing, the second housing including an inhalation port;

a liquid storage component and an atomizing core in the second housing, the atomizing core including a wire coil electrically connectable to the battery for atomizing liquid from the liquid storage component;

the atomizing core centrally supported in the second housing on a bracket;

an electrode ring on the bracket;

a ring post in the first housing engageable with the electrode ring, the wire coil electrically connected to the battery through the ring post and the electrode ring; and

a channel extending through and surrounded by the liquid storage component, with the channel and the inhalation port forming an airflow path centrally located within the second housing, and with the channel providing a continuous unobstructed passageway from the wire coil to the inhalation port.
